11. Hell and destruction are before the LORD: how much more then the hearts of the children of men?
Iov 26.6Hell is naked before him, and destruction hath no covering. ;
Ps 139.8If I ascend up into heaven, thou art there: if I make my bed in hell, behold, thou art there. ;
2Cron 6.30Then hear thou from heaven thy dwelling place, and forgive, and render unto every man according unto all his ways, whose heart thou knowest; (for thou only knowest the hearts of the children of men:) ;
Ps 7.9Oh let the wickedness of the wicked come to an end; but establish the just: for the righteous God trieth the hearts and reins. ;
Ps 44.21Shall not God search this out? for he knoweth the secrets of the heart. ;
Ioan 2.24-25But Jesus did not commit himself unto them, because he knew all men, ;
Ioan 21.17He saith unto him the third time, Simon, son of Jonas, lovest thou me? Peter was grieved because he said unto him the third time, Lovest thou me? And he said unto him, Lord, thou knowest all things; thou knowest that I love thee. Jesus saith unto him, Feed my sheep. ;
Fapt 1.24And they prayed, and said, Thou, Lord, which knowest the hearts of all men, shew whether of these two thou hast chosen, ;
12. A scorner loveth not one that reproveth him: neither will he go unto the wise.
Amos 5.10They hate him that rebuketh in the gate, and they abhor him that speaketh uprightly. ;
2Tim 4.3For the time will come when they will not endure sound doctrine; but after their own lusts shall they heap to themselves teachers, having itching ears; ;
13. A merry heart maketh a cheerful countenance: but by sorrow of the heart the spirit is broken.
Prov 17.22A merry heart doeth good like a medicine: but a broken spirit drieth the bones. ;
Prov 12.25Heaviness in the heart of man maketh it stoop: but a good word maketh it glad. ;
14. The heart of him that hath understanding seeketh knowledge: but the mouth of fools feedeth on foolishness.
15. All the days of the afflicted are evil: but he that is of a merry heart hath a continual feast.
Prov 17.22A merry heart doeth good like a medicine: but a broken spirit drieth the bones. ;
16. Better is little with the fear of the LORD than great treasure and trouble therewith.
Ps 37.16A little that a righteous man hath is better than the riches of many wicked. ;
Prov 16.8Better is a little with righteousness than great revenues without right. ;
1Tim 6.6But godliness with contentment is great gain. ;
17. Better is a dinner of herbs where love is, than a stalled ox and hatred therewith.
Prov 17.1Better is a dry morsel, and quietness therewith, than an house full of sacrifices with strife. ;
18. A wrathful man stirreth up strife: but he that is slow to anger appeaseth strife.
Prov 26.21As coals are to burning coals, and wood to fire; so is a contentious man to kindle strife. ;
Prov 29.22An angry man stirreth up strife, and a furious man aboundeth in transgression. ;
19. The way of the slothful man is as an hedge of thorns: but the way of the righteous is made plain.
Prov 22.5Thorns and snares are in the way of the froward: he that doth keep his soul shall be far from them. ;
20. A wise son maketh a glad father: but a foolish man despiseth his mother.
Prov 10.1The proverbs of Solomon. A wise son maketh a glad father: but a foolish son is the heaviness of his mother. ;
Prov 29.3Whoso loveth wisdom rejoiceth his father: but he that keepeth company with harlots spendeth his substance. ;
